The Master Production Planner is responsible for developing and maintaining a master production schedule that details the production requirements, quantities, timing and minimizes production disruptions through optimized production planning. The role is responsible for driving high levels of on-time shipment commitments by scheduling by incorporating capacity and other constraints when scheduling to drive increased customer satisfaction and facility performance. This role is critical in balancing material availability, production capacity, and inventory targets while adhering to strict production and product guidelines. The Master Scheduler also interfaces with the Enterprise Supply Chain Scheduling team on balancing facility production inputs/outputs, support the enterprise SIOP and is the focal point of timely order updates to the commercial teams and others.


  • Analyze demand and supply at the product, customer, and master schedule levels, determine out of balance conditions, identify alternative and recommend actions for approval.
  • Collaborate with sales, enterprise scheduling, and manufacturing to understand and reduce internal and customer lead-times.
  • Conduct rough-cut capacity planning prior to publishing master schedule to ensure alignment with SIOP and budget commitments.
  • Oversee operations execution commitments within the product lines to ensure efficient detailed scheduling and utilization of capacity.
  • Identify, negotiate, and resolve conflicts with respect to material and capacity availability and order-promising integrity across the product lines.
  • Create a master schedule that satisfies customer demand while leveling workload released to manufacturing, and optimization of revenue, inventory levels and resource utilization and releases work order to the production floor.
  • Maintain scheduling parameters, such as lead-times, lot sizes, and cycle times.
  • Monitor the implementation of schedules and evaluate their success as well as assess and mitigate risks that may impact the schedule
  • Proactively identify potential scheduling conflicts or bottlenecks and work with relevant departments to resolve them.
  • Collaborate closely with Production, Purchasing, Materials, Quality and others as necessary to ensure that the schedule is realistic and aligns with overall business objectives.
  • Evaluate and adjust schedules to account for inventories and capacity constraints.
  • Analyze forecast accuracy and production trends to improve scheduling efficiency and reduce waste or overproduction.
  • Participate in daily/weekly production meetings and provide visibility to capacity constraints, schedule changes, and priority shifts.
  • Communicates schedule changes to correspondent stakeholders as changes occur.
  • Review upcoming projects for complexity, special build requirement, line and capacity requirements, manpower allocation, etc.
  • Identify areas for process improvement within the scheduling function and implement changes to meet stated lead times.
